Pakatan-led minority govt can resolve political stalemate: S’wak activist

KUCHING – A Sarawak activist is calling on the Borneo bloc of Gabungan Parti Sarawak (GPS) and Gabungan Rakyat Sabah to support the formation of a minority government with Pakatan Harapan (PH) chairman Datuk Seri Anwar Ibrahim at its head.

With no party or coalition able to command a simple majority, Peter John Jaban said this model, practised in other countries with hung parliaments, will allow Malaysia to move on from the current stalemate while also honouring the results of the 15th general election (GE15).
